Hi Lambert,

What you could do is to make a function what just takes in a file name as
input and call the templated ITK function inside as an inline function.
There is no way I know to do I/O in ITK without using templates.

>>> Hi Lambert,
>>>
>>> This example shows how to read in an unknown image type. It
>>> demonstrates how to go between run-time type specification and the
>>> compile-image type specification of ITK.
>>>
>>>
>>> http://itk.org/ITKExamples/src/IO/ImageBase/ReadUnknownImageType/Documentation.html
>>>
>>> This approach could be used for your problem.

>>> > Dear itk users,
>>> > I'm new to itk and also not very proficient in C++...
>>> > I want to try some deformable registration methods implemented in itk,
>>> and
>>> > need to convert my own format of images and volumes to itk, and back.
>>> > For conversion to itk, I use 'ImportImageFilter', because I do not
>>> want to
>>> > make a copy of the pixels/voxels.
>>> > Converting itk images and volumes back to my own format, is giving me a
>>> > headache; I'm confused about 'Image', SmartPointer and ConstPointer and
>>> > template stuff.
>>> > Could you get me started by suggesting me a function prototype?
>>> >
>>> > Something like:
>>> > int ItkToMyFormat(MyFormat** ppMyFormat, itk::Image* pItkImage);
>>> >
>>> > The ItkImage can be any pixeltype, any dimension, and vector images
>>> should
>>> > also be accepted by the conversion routine. In that conversion
>>> function, and
>>> > need to be able to put a switch on pixeltype and number of dimensions.
